Find the Halfway Point Between Two Cities (Free Tool + Tips)

To find the halfway point between two cities, drop both cities into a midpoint tool, let it calculate the center, then snap that center to the nearest real town with a parking lot and a decent diner. That’s the whole method, and it takes about ninety seconds. The catch most people miss is that the raw geographic center and the spot where each driver spends equal time are often two different towns once roads and traffic enter the math. Get that distinction right and the “who drives farther” fight disappears.

How to Find the Halfway Point Between Two Cities

To find the halfway point between two cities, drop both cities into a midpoint tool, let it calculate the center, then snap that center to the nearest real town. Most tools define “the middle” one of two ways: the geographic center (pure latitude and longitude math) or the travel-time center (the spot where each driver spends roughly equal minutes). That distinction changes your answer, sometimes by an entire town.

Here’s the fast version:

  1. Enter city one and city two.
  2. Choose whether you want equal time or equal distance.
  3. Read the midpoint plus each driver’s split.
  4. Slide the result to the nearest town with food, fuel, and parking.

The geographic midpoint is fast but blind to roads. The travel-time midpoint accounts for highways, speed limits, and traffic, which is why it usually wins for a road-trip meetup. Pick the wrong definition and one person ends up on backroads for an extra forty minutes while the map insists it’s even.

Geographic Midpoint vs Travel-Time Midpoint

The geographic midpoint is raw coordinate math: average the two latitudes and longitudes, drop a pin. The travel-time midpoint is the spot where each driver clocks roughly equal minutes behind the wheel. These can land in different towns the moment one party gets a clean interstate and the other gets a two-lane county road. The halfway point that feels fair is where both people spend equal time getting there, not the center of a map. For most meetups, travel time is the number that decides who feels cheated.

Halfway by Distance vs Halfway by Time

Halfway is a choice, not a fixed dot. Equal miles and equal minutes produce different results, and equal time tends to feel fairer when one side faces highways and the other faces backroads. A 60-mile stretch of stop-and-go can eat the same hour as 90 miles of open freeway. Quick rule: if both drivers are on similar road types, distance is fine. If one is on highway and the other on rural roads, choose time. For more on why the route you see isn’t always the route most people take, see our guide to comparing driving routes between two points.

Use a Free Halfway Point Tool

Map with two cities marked by pins, a ruler measuring the distance between them, and a highlighted point in the center on a w

A free midpoint finder does the math and the venue search in one pass. The steps are short:

  1. Enter city one (full address or ZIP for a tighter result).
  2. Enter city two.
  3. Pick time or distance as your fairness metric.
  4. Read the midpoint and each driver’s distance and drive time.
  5. Browse nearby venues, then lock in a real spot.

Tools like MeetWays and Mappr will also surface cafes, restaurants, and parks near the center, which turns a coordinate into a plan. Entering full addresses or ZIP codes returns a sharper midpoint than city names alone, because “Chicago” and “a specific Chicago suburb” can sit thirty miles apart.

What to Enter for an Accurate Result

Input quality decides everything. Vague inputs push the midpoint off by miles, and a midpoint off by miles can mean the wrong town entirely. Your options:

  • Full street addresses: the most accurate, best for local meetups.
  • ZIP codes: good when you want privacy but still want precision.
  • Coordinates: useful for remote or rural starting points with no clear address.
  • City names: fine for a rough read or long-distance flights, weak for a lunch meetup.

Find the Halfway Point on Google Maps

If you’d rather not open a separate tool, Google Maps does it manually. Get directions between your two cities, click to add a stop partway along the route, then drag that stop until both legs show similar drive times. When the two numbers match, you’ve found your travel-time midpoint. Because Maps shows live traffic, the drive times shift with conditions, which is exactly what you want when fairness depends on minutes rather than miles. Upside: free and traffic-aware. Downside: manual, approximate, and a little fiddly.

The Measure Distance Trick

For a quick straight-line sanity check, right-click your starting city, choose “Measure distance,” then click the second city. The number it gives you is as-the-crow-flies, not drivable, so use it to ballpark whether a midpoint is even worth calculating. It’s useless for drive-time fairness, but handy when you just want to know if two cities are an hour apart or six.

Snap the Midpoint to a Real Meeting Town

Google Maps interface on smartphone screen showing a route between two cities with a red pin marking the midpoint location on

Here’s the gap most tools gloss over: the raw GPS midpoint often lands in a soybean field or on a stretch of interstate with no exit for twelve miles. Nobody meets there. The fix is to slide the point to the nearest town that has food, fuel, and parking. A midpoint finder that lists venues makes this easy; a coordinate tool makes you do it by eye. Either way, the goal is the same, turning a number into a place two people will actually agree on. For a worked example of the same midpoint-to-real-place logic on a fixed route, see our distance breakdown for a long-haul drive.

What to Check Before You Pick the Spot

Run this checklist before you commit:

  • Highway access within a few minutes of the exit.
  • At least one or two real restaurants, not just a vending machine.
  • Gas within a few miles for the drive home.
  • Easy, free parking that fits both vehicles.
  • Opening hours that match your meet time.
  • Seasonal closures and early-closing small towns (a lot of rural diners shut by 8pm or close Mondays entirely).

Make the Split Feel Fair to Both Drivers

Put both drivers side by side and the fairness becomes visible. A clean 50/50 on the map can still feel lopsided if one side hits tolls or rush-hour traffic.

Driver Distance Drive time Road type
Driver A 95 mi 1 hr 35 min Interstate
Driver B 72 mi 1 hr 38 min County roads

Driver B covers 23 fewer miles but spends two minutes longer. That’s a fair split by time and an unfair-looking one by distance. Show the numbers and the argument ends.

When to Skew the Midpoint on Purpose

You can nudge the meeting spot off the mathematical center for a good reason. Three examples:

  • Give the city driver a shorter distance but the same time, since they’re already fighting traffic to get out of town.
  • Push toward a safer, better-lit town when one party arrives after dark.
  • Shift toward a town with a real attraction so the meetup is worth the drive, not just a parking-lot handoff.

Halfway Points for Different Trip Types

The “right” midpoint shifts with the trip. A romantic weekend wants a town with a good dinner spot and somewhere to walk. A kid-heavy family meetup wants a park, a clean restroom, and a parking lot that fits two minivans. An overnight stop on a long haul wants safe lodging near the highway. Same coordinate, three different filters. Most tools let you search by venue type, so set the filter before you fall in love with a town that has nothing your trip needs.

Overnight Stops on Long Drives

On routes long enough to need a sleep break, like a multi-day cross-country leg, the exact center matters less than a midpoint town with safe lodging near the highway. AAA-style fatigue guidance suggests breaking long drives well before exhaustion sets in, so aim for a town with a clean hotel and gas, even if it’s twenty miles off the perfect center.

Meeting Three or More People

Multi-point midpoint finders take several starting cities and return one central spot plus each person’s drive. They’re built for family reunions and scattered friend groups, often handling two to six locations at once. The payoff is shared burden: instead of one person driving four hours while everyone else drives one, the tool finds the spot that spreads the miles as evenly as the map allows.

Halfway Points for Flights and International Trips

Two people meeting at a town center fountain, checking a map on a smartphone while pointing toward different directions

For air travel and cross-border planning, exact addresses matter less, so city-level inputs are fine. Say one person flies from Dallas and the other from Toronto: enter both city names into a geographic midpoint tool and it points you near Chicago, which tells you to compare flights into O’Hare or Midway rather than guess. Use cities, not street addresses, here; the precision you’d want for a lunch meetup is wasted when you’re choosing between two metro areas a hundred miles apart.

Where Halfway Tools Fall Short

Set honest expectations. ETAs drift with traffic, road closures and rural gaps throw off the math, and “halfway” is a strong starting point rather than a promise. Treat the result as a draft, then sanity-check it against real roads. One more thing, on privacy: share the midpoint or the venue, not everyone’s home address. When you’re meeting someone you only know online, use cross streets or a ZIP code as your input instead of your front door, and send the group only the final spot.

Our Take

Skip the back-and-forth and let the tool answer in ninety seconds. Use the time-based split, snap to a town with food and parking, and skew the center on purpose when fairness asks for it. The math is the easy part. Picking a place worth meeting at is the part worth your attention.

FAQs about find halfway point between two cities

How do I find the halfway point between two cities for a road trip?

Enter both cities into a free midpoint tool, choose equal drive time over equal distance, then read each driver’s split. Slide the result to the nearest town with food, fuel, and parking.

Is the halfway point based on distance or travel time?

It can be either, and they often land in different towns. For road trips, travel time usually feels fairer because traffic and road quality can make a shorter-on-paper stretch take just as long.

How do I find the halfway point between two cities on Google Maps?

Get directions between the two cities, add a stop partway along the route, then drag that stop until both legs show similar drive times. It’s free and uses live traffic, but it’s approximate.

Can I find a halfway point between more than two cities?

Yes. Multi-point midpoint finders handle two to six (or more) locations at once and return one central spot plus each person’s drive time, which helps spread the driving burden across a group.

How do I find a fair spot if one person is in a city and the other is rural?

Use the equal-time setting instead of equal-distance. The city driver may cover fewer miles but spend the same minutes thanks to traffic, so a time-based midpoint feels fairer to both.

Can I use coordinates or ZIP codes instead of full addresses?

Yes. ZIP codes work well when you want privacy, and coordinates are best for remote starting points with no clear address. Full addresses give the tightest result for local meetups.

How accurate are midpoint calculators for long cross-country trips?

They’re a strong starting point, not a guarantee. ETAs drift, road closures and rural gaps skew the math, and the longer the route, the more a small percentage error adds up. Sanity-check the result.

How do I find a safe overnight stop halfway on a long drive?

Look for a midpoint town with lodging near a highway exit rather than the exact mathematical center. Prioritize gas, a clean hotel, and well-lit access over hitting the precise middle.

Are there free apps to find the halfway point between two places?

Yes. Several free tools and mobile apps calculate midpoints by time or distance and surface nearby venues. Many run in a browser, and some offer iOS apps for planning on the road.

Can I find a restaurant or hotel exactly halfway between two locations?

Many midpoint tools let you filter by venue type, so you can search for a restaurant, cafe, park, or hotel near the center. Pick the spot from those results instead of accepting a bare coordinate.